Why Ecostudio Fellini Are Seeing A Rise In Mid-week Weddings

Award-winning Hinterland wedding venue, Ecostudio Fellini, experienced a 50% increase in bookings during the 2017 financial year, with a rise in mid-week wedding bookings from couples looking to create their dream day.

Image

The mid-week wedding trend is being embraced by an increasing number of couples due to the availability of the best wedding suppliers and venues on days such as Wednesday, Thursday and Friday as opposed to the weekend.

With many guests travelling from interstate, the mid-week wedding also has added benefits for bridal parties, as family and friends are presented with the ideal opportunity to take a mini-break from work.

Ecostudio Fellini co-owner Carlo Percuoco said the mid-week wedding trend is having a noted impact on the multi-award winning venue that was recently voted number one wedding venue restaurant by the Bride’s Choice Awards in 2016, as well as being a finalist for best reception and best ceremony venue in the 2017 Australian Bridal Industry Academy’s Queensland awards.

“The mid-week wedding is a great way for couples to bypass high weekend demand to secure the crème de la crème of wedding services without the hassle of competing with other couples. We have definitely noticed the rise in popularity of weekday weddings here at Ecostudio Fellini, with mid-week weddings increasing our overall bookings by 50% this last financial year." 

Bookings on Thursdays and Fridays have proven especially popular, as they provide the perfect excuse for guests to take a long weekend off work to celebrate with their friends and loved ones.

- Carlo Percuoco (Ecostudio Fellini Co-owner)

"With Saturday and Sunday weddings often booked out well in advance, it is great to see couples open their minds to the possibility of a mid-week wedding and the advantages it can give them. We love being a part of any wedding, and when a couple has the freedom to create their dream day down to the finest detail it always makes for an extra special and joyous occasion.” – Carlo Percuoco
